A woman who accused music luminaries Shawn "Jay-Z" Carter and Sean "Diddy" Combs of raping her in 2000 has dismissed her lawsuit, according to court records released on Friday.

The federal court filing in Manhattan reveals that the lawsuit was dismissed with prejudice, meaning the case cannot be brought back to the court.

The decision follows negotiations between the plaintiff's legal team and the defense attorneys, resulting in the voluntary withdrawal of the accusations.
